3. Four point charges are placed at the four corners of a square that is 30 cm on each side. Two of the 4 charges are +2μC and two are -2μC. Find the potential at the center of the square.

 

4. The potential difference between two parallel plates of a condenser that are 4 mm apart is 800 V. What is the potential gradient?

3. The net potential

Vnet=kq1r1+kq2r2+kq3r3+kq4r4V_{net}=k\frac{q_1}{r_1}+k\frac{q_2}{r_2}+k\frac{q_3}{r_3}+k\frac{q_4}{r_4}r1=r2=r3=r4=22a=220.3=0.21mr_1=r_2=r_3=r_4=\frac{\sqrt{2}}{2}a\\ =\frac{\sqrt{2}}{2}*0.3=0.21\:\rm m

Vnet=91090.21(2+222)106=0VV_{net}=\frac{9*10^9}{0.21}(2+2-2-2)*10^{-6}=0\:\rm V

4.

ΔVΔd=800V0.004m=2105V/m\frac{\Delta V}{\Delta d}=\frac{800\:\rm V}{0.004\: \rm m}=2*10^5\:\rm V/m
